Free Printable Ring Sizer Tool (Accurate!)

A readily available template, often in PDF format, designed for printing and subsequent use to determine ring size accurately. These templates commonly feature a series of graduated circles representing standard ring sizes, or a marked ruler to measure finger circumference, thus enabling users to find their ideal ring fit at home. For example, a user might print such a template, place a ring on the circle that matches its inner diameter, and identify the corresponding size number.

The utility of these templates lies in their convenience and accessibility. Prior to their widespread availability, determining ring size often necessitated a visit to a jeweler. These printed aids provide a cost-effective and time-saving alternative, particularly beneficial for individuals purchasing rings online or as gifts. Historically, ring sizing involved specialized tools and professional expertise; the emergence of easily accessible templates has democratized the process.

Frequently Asked Questions About Templates for Determining Ring Size

This section addresses common inquiries and concerns regarding the use of printed templates for ascertaining appropriate ring dimensions. Understanding the nuances of these tools is critical for achieving accurate sizing and avoiding potential discrepancies.

Question 1: Are printed templates an accurate method for determining ring size?

While offering convenience, their accuracy depends heavily on the precision of the printing process. Discrepancies in scaling during printing can lead to inaccurate measurements. Calibration with a ruler after printing is strongly recommended.

Question 2: What type of paper is best suited for printing a ring sizing template?

Standard printer paper is generally sufficient. However, thicker paper stock can improve durability and reduce the likelihood of distortion during handling and measurement.

Question 3: How can one ensure the printed template is scaled correctly?

Most templates include a test line or a reference measurement that should be verified with a physical ruler after printing. If the measurement deviates from the indicated value, adjustments to the printer settings are necessary.

Question 4: Can temperature affect the accuracy of a printed template?

Yes, significant temperature fluctuations can cause paper to expand or contract slightly, potentially affecting the dimensions of the template. It is advisable to use the template in a stable, moderate temperature environment.

Question 5: Are all templates for ring sizing created equal?

No. The accuracy and consistency of templates can vary significantly depending on the source. Reputable sources that provide clear instructions and verification methods are preferred.

Question 6: What are the limitations of relying solely on a printed template for ring sizing?

These tools provide an approximation. Factors such as finger shape, knuckle size, and ring band width can influence the ideal fit. Consulting a jeweler for professional sizing is recommended for significant or high-value ring purchases.

In summary, while offering a convenient initial estimate, printed ring sizing templates are not foolproof. Careful attention to printing accuracy and awareness of individual factors affecting fit are crucial for optimal results.

Tips for Accurate Sizing with a Printable Ring Sizer Tool

Employing a printed template for ascertaining ring dimensions necessitates adherence to specific guidelines to maximize accuracy and mitigate potential errors. The following tips provide a framework for achieving optimal results.

Tip 1: Verify Print Scale. Upon printing, immediately confirm that the template’s scale matches the indicated measurement. A ruler should be used to measure the test line, ensuring it corresponds precisely to the length specified on the template. Discrepancies necessitate adjustments to printer settings until accurate scaling is achieved.

Tip 2: Utilize Appropriate Paper. While standard printer paper is acceptable, card stock or a similar heavier weight paper provides greater durability and reduces the potential for distortion. Avoid thin or glossy paper types, as they can be more susceptible to stretching or tearing.

Tip 3: Consider Finger Circumstances. Finger size can fluctuate due to temperature, hydration levels, and time of day. It is advisable to measure at different times to account for these variations. Avoid measuring when fingers are cold, as they tend to be smaller.

Tip 4: Overlap Strategically. When employing a template that requires wrapping around the finger, ensure a snug but comfortable fit. Overlapping the template excessively can lead to an undersized measurement. A slight overlap, securing the template with tape, provides a more representative indication of finger circumference.

Tip 5: Account for Knuckle Size. If the knuckle is significantly larger than the base of the finger, the ring must be sized appropriately to pass over the knuckle comfortably. In such cases, prioritize the knuckle measurement over the base of the finger. It might be prudent to test fit with a ring that successfully navigates the knuckle.

Tip 6: Understand Band Width Implications: Wider ring bands generally require a slightly larger size than narrower bands. The greater surface area of a wider band can create a tighter fit. Therefore, individuals intending to wear a wide band ring should consider sizing up by a quarter or half size.

Adhering to these guidelines enhances the reliability of measurements obtained from a printed template. Accuracy hinges on meticulous attention to detail throughout the process.
